Amana Moves Media to Carat

Company Cites Costs in Leaving DDB; Creative Review May Follow
NEW YORK„Carat USA has won the estimated $20 million media buying account of Amana Appliances, the client confirmed.
The account was awarded to the media company›s Chicago office last week after a review of undisclosed agencies.
Amana parted ways in early November with DDB Worldwide, New York, which had handled media and creative duties for the appliance maker.
˜Their services became cost-prohibitive,” said company representative Callista Gould.
˜But their media services were excellent.”
The Iowa-based client has pulled creative duties in-house, but a source said at least part of the creative account will be put into review in the coming months.
